I Dumped My Toxic In-Laws at Wedding

A high-earning designer is forced to wash her mother-in-law’s feet at her wedding and finally fights back. She teams up with a sharp lawyer and her strong family to break off the engagement and reclaim all her assets against her vicious in-laws. Unmoved by their begging, she coldly declares every member of the family will get punished.
